Rock Band Announced for Wii
Posted by Guest, 348 days ago Jan 31, 2008 23:32
  Rock Band
  Articles | FAQ | Achievements | Files | Media | Video | Cheats | Boards | Buy Now

While Rock Band developer Harmonix has said on multiple occasions that they would love to do something for the Wii, MTV Games and Electronic Arts weren’t willing to confirm a release of the popular music game. Rock Band is currently available on Xbox 360, PS3 and PS2, but not offering a SKU for the Wii, which sold like gangbusters in the last year, just doesn’t make good business sense.

Thankfully for Wii owners, EA and MTV Games aren’t insane and they want Wii gamers’ money as well. In the conference call following EA’s Q3 fiscal results, EA CEO John Riccitiello confirmed that a Wii version of Rock Band is indeed in the works. Unfortunately EA did not share any other details about the game or when it might ship.

Riccitiello did, however, emphasize the importance of Rock Band in general for EA in the fourth quarter and the first half of fiscal 2009, when the game ships across Europe.
